what The UK and Europe are missing is that link between Universities/Colleges into Challenge Tour - the US have the college system and many of the top golfers go through that and into Korn Ferry as it’s called now
We just don’t have that system in place and the Europro provided something for those talented young players looking for the next step up
Shame to lose it as it has helped some players progress
